The SEDRIS Data Representation Model
APPENDIX A - Classes Attachment Point |
---|
An instance of this DRM class specifies a <Location 3D> where a consuming application may attach other <Model> instances.
Consider an aircraft <Model>, the hard points of which are represented as <Attachment Point> instances. Consider a second <Model>, representing a missile. One missile hangs below the wing, and another missile hangs from the tip of the wing. In this case, the matrix formed by the <Attachment Point> instances would convey the appropriate rotation. The missile, on the other hand, would use an <LSR Transformation> to move the missile's origin (which would probably be its <Geometric Centre> SE_GEOM_CTR_CODE_CENTRE_OF_MASS) to the point on or near the surface where it attaches to the airplane's <Attachment Point> instances.
